我有一个包含几个列的CSV文件,我想编写一个代码,它将读取一个名为'ARPU平均6个月w/t漫游和折扣‘的特定列,然后创建一个名为"Logical“的新列,该列将基于numpy.where()。我现在得到的是:
data = csv_data[['ARPU average 6 month w/t roaming and它不会为每一行创建一个具有相应值的新列。为了说明这一点:如果列中的值<
3 2007 300 Null (no baseline value in 2007)
每个门店关键字和销售年份都有一个由促销关键字1指示的基准值。所有其他促销关键字都反映了我希望划分为相同门店关键字和销售年度的基准值的条目。类似地,具有商店关键字1和2008年的所有条目除以该年的基准值(商店1和销售年度2008的促销关键字1)。同样,对于商店2,我希望促销密钥2的商店密钥2和年份2009除以基准值